DeskIntegrator, Add Program Links To Windows Right-Click Menu

DeskIntegrator is a small portable program for the Windows operating system that can be used to add program links directly to the desktop right-click menu. We all know that it is possible to add those links manually to the context menu using the Windows Registry, and DeskIntegrator basically offers to graphical user interface for the [...]
